BACKGROUND: Results from phase II studies in patients with stage IIIA non-small-cell lung cancer with ipsilateral mediastinal nodal metastases (N2) have shown the feasibility of resection after concurrent chemotherapy and radiotherapy with promising rates of survival. We therefore did this phase III trial to compare concurrent chemotherapy and radiotherapy followed by resection with standard concurrent chemotherapy and definitive radiotherapy without resection. METHODS: Patients with stage T1-3pN2M0 non-small-cell lung cancer were randomly assigned in a 1:1 ratio to concurrent induction chemotherapy (two cycles of cisplatin [50 mg/m(2) on days 1, 8, 29, and 36] and etoposide [50 mg/m(2) on days 1-5 and 29-33]) plus radiotherapy (45 Gy) in multiple academic and community hospitals. If no progression, patients in group 1 underwent resection and those in group 2 continued radiotherapy uninterrupted up to 61 Gy. Two additional cycles of cisplatin and etoposide were given in both groups. The primary endpoint was overall survival (OS). Analysis was by intention to treat. This study is registered with ClinicalTrials.gov, number NCT00002550. FINDINGS: 202 patients (median age 59 years, range 31-77) were assigned to group 1 and 194 (61 years, 32-78) to group 2. Median OS was 23.6 months (IQR 9.0-not reached) in group 1 versus 22.2 months (9.4-52.7) in group 2 (hazard ratio [HR] 0.87 [0.70-1.10]; p=0.24). Number of patients alive at 5 years was 37 (point estimate 27%) in group 1 and 24 (point estimate 20%) in group 2 (odds ratio 0.63 [0.36-1.10]; p=0.10). With N0 status at thoracotomy, the median OS was 34.4 months (IQR 15.7-not reached; 19 [point estimate 41%] patients alive at 5 years). Progression-free survival (PFS) was better in group 1 than in group 2, median 12.8 months (5.3-42.2) vs 10.5 months (4.8-20.6), HR 0.77 [0.62-0.96]; p=0.017); the number of patients without disease progression at 5 years was 32 (point estimate 22%) versus 13 (point estimate 11%), respectively. Neutropenia and oesophagitis were the main grade 3 or 4 toxicities associated with chemotherapy plus radiotherapy in group 1 (77 [38%] and 20 [10%], respectively) and group 2 (80 [41%] and 44 [23%], respectively). In group 1, 16 (8%) deaths were treatment related versus four (2%) in group 2. In an exploratory analysis, OS was improved for patients who underwent lobectomy, but not pneumonectomy, versus chemotherapy plus radiotherapy. INTERPRETATION: Chemotherapy plus radiotherapy with or without resection (preferably lobectomy) are options for patients with stage IIIA(N2) non-small-cell lung cancer. PURPOSES: This systematic review addressed the following key questions on managing small cell lung cancer (SCLC): the sequence, timing, and dosing characteristics of primary thoracic radiotherapy (TRTx) for limited-stage disease; primary TRTx for extensive-stage disease; effect of prophylactic cranial irradiation (PCI); positron emission tomography (PET) for staging; treatment of mixed histology tumors; surgery; and second-line and subsequent-line treatment for relapsed/progressive disease. METHODS: The review methods were defined prospectively in a written protocol. We primarily sought randomized controlled trials that compared the interventions of interest. RESULTS: Robust evidence was lacking for all questions except PCI, for which a patient-level metaanalysis showed that PCI improves survival of SCLC patients who achieved complete response after primary therapy from 15.3 to 20.7% (p = 0.01). The case for concurrent over sequential radiation delivery rests largely on a single multicenter trial. Support for early concurrent therapy comes from one multicenter trial, but two other multicenter trials found no advantage. Metaanalysis did not find significant reductions in 2-year and 3-year mortality rates for early TRTx. Favorable results from a single-center trial on TRTx for extensive stage disease need replication in a multicenter setting. Relevant comparative studies were nonexistent for management of mixed histology disease and surgery for early limited SCLC. PET may be more sensitive in detecting extracranial disease than conventional staging modalities, but studies were of poor quality. CONCLUSIONS: PCI improves survival among those with a complete remission to primary therapy. A research agenda is needed to optimize the effectiveness of TRTx and its components.

PURPOSE: There are no published survival data after chemoradiotherapy (chemoRT) in pathologically documented stage IIIB non-small-cell lung cancer. Studies of radiotherapy (RT) alone or chemotherapy followed by RT yield 5-year survivals less than 10%. The Southwest Oncology Group (SWOG) employed the same concurrent chemoRT induction regimen used in its predecessor trimodality trial to determine the efficacy, safety, and long-term outcome of replacing postinduction surgery with additional chemoRT. PATIENTS AND METHODS: Eligible patients for SWOG-9019 had pathologic documentation of T4N0/1, T4N2, or N3 stage IIIB non-small-cell lung cancer. They had pulmonary function adequate to withstand combined-modality therapy, identical to the requirements of the previous trial with postchemoRT surgery. Induction therapy was two cycles of cisplatin plus etoposide (PE) concurrent with once-daily thoracic RT (45 Gy). In the absence of progressive disease, RT was completed to 61 Gy, with two additional cycles of cisplatin plus etoposide. RESULTS: Fifty eligible patients were accrued with tumor-node (TN) substage confirmed on central review: 18, T4N0/1; 12, T4N2; and 20, N3. Grade 4 neutropenia was the most common toxicity (32%). Grade 3/4 esophagitis occurred in 12% and 8%. Median follow-up was 52 months, and overall median survival was 15 months (10 to 22, 95% confidence interval). Three- and 5-year survivals were 17% and 15% (5-year T4N0/1, 17%; T4N2, 13%; and N3, 15%). CONCLUSION: Feasibility and long-term survival support the application of these results as a standard against which mature outcomes of chemoRT trials with new chemotherapy agents can be compared. These results also justify use of the SWOG-9019 approach as a control arm in ongoing phase III trials.

Stage IIIa non-small cell lung cancer remains categorically a heterogeneous hodgepodge without clear prospective mandates for clinical care. Poor outcome ensues for patients with mediastinal node-positive cancer when treated with surgery alone, but we are unclear how to define subsets that might benefit from surgery. This article reviews significant trials of surgery and chemoradiotherapy, including those using induction chemotherapy for stage III patients. While many continue to believe that chemotherapy without RT may provide equivalent pathologic complete response and survival rates, there is very little apparent difference in survival between patients managed with surgery or those managed to a higher dose of radiotherapy with concurrent chemotherapy (using an established chemotherapy regimen, 2-dimensional radiotherapy treatment planning, and a dose of only 61 Gy). If there is any benefit to surgery in the IIIa as currently staged, the benefit is very small and is counterbalanced by operative risk.

Over the past two decades, studies of the Southwest Oncology Group have consistently reported stable esophagitis rates despite changing scales with concurrent chest radiotherapy and cisplatin/etoposide regimens. Patient selection has perhaps contributed to increased survival over this period. The Southwest Oncology Group has incorporated surgical questions and advanced the field with a steady use of consistent therapies (ie, cisplatin/etoposide plus radiotherapy of 45 Gy [induction therapy] and cisplatin/etoposide plus at least 61 Gy) in potentially operable or unresectable disease. Further studies examining the addition of either docetaxel or novel agents to such regimens are underway.

Twenty consecutive patients with kidney graft rejection refractory to chemical immunosuppression were treated with local irradiation to the transplanted renal graft (3 x 1.5 Gy). Ten patients were complete responders (median follow-up: 47 months). Six patients were partial responders and failed after 1-4 months. Four patients did not respond.

PURPOSE: The American College of Chest Physicians (ACCP) produced an evidence-based guideline on treatment of patients with small-cell lung cancer (SCLC). Because of the relevance of this guideline to American Society of Clinical Oncology (ASCO) membership, ASCO reviewed the guideline, applying a set of procedures and policies used to critically examine guidelines developed by other organizations. METHODS: The ACCP guideline on the treatment of SCLC was reviewed for developmental rigor by methodologists. An ASCO Endorsement Panel updated the literature search, reviewed the content, and considered additional recommendations. RESULTS: The ASCO Endorsement Panel determined that the recommendations from the ACCP guideline, published in 2013, are clear, thorough, and based on current scientific evidence. ASCO endorses the ACCP guideline on the treatment of SCLC, with the addition of qualifying statements. RECOMMENDATIONS: Surgery is indicated for selected stage I SCLC. Limited-stage disease should be treated with concurrent chemoradiotherapy in patients with good performance status. Thoracic radiotherapy should be administered early in the course of treatment, preferably beginning with cycle one or two of chemotherapy. Chemotherapy should consist of four cycles of a platinum agent and etoposide. Extensive-stage disease should be treated primarily with chemotherapy consisting of a platinum agent plus etoposide or irinotecan. Prophylactic cranial irradiation prolongs survival in patients with limited-stage disease who achieve a complete or partial response to initial therapy and may do so in similarly responding patients with extensive-stage disease as well. BACKGROUND: Despite advances in early detection and effective treatment, cancer remains one of the most feared diseases. Among the most common side effects of cancer and treatments for cancer are pain, depression, and fatigue. Although research is producing increasingly hopeful insights into the causes and cures for cancer, efforts to manage the side effects of the disease and its treatments have not kept pace. The challenge that faces us is how to increase awareness of the importance of recognizing and actively addressing cancer-related distress. The National Institutes of Health (NIH) convened a State-of-the-Science Conference on Symptom Management in Cancer: Pain, Depression, and Fatigue to examine the current state of knowledge regarding the management of pain, depression, and fatigue in individuals with cancer and to identify directions for future research. Specifically, the conference examined how to identify individuals who are at risk for cancer-related pain, depression, and/or fatigue; what treatments work best to address these symptoms when they occur; and what is the best way to deliver interventions across the continuum of care. STATE-OF-THE-SCIENCE PROCESS: A non-advocate, non-Federal, 14-member panel of experts representing the fields of oncology, radiology, psychology, nursing, public health, social work, and epidemiology prepared the statement. In addition, 24 experts in medical oncology, geriatrics, pharmacology, psychology, and neurology presented data to the panel and to the conference audience during the first 1.5 days of the conference. The panel then prepared its statement, addressing the five predetermined questions and drawing on submitted literature, the speakers' presentations, and discussions held at the conference. The statement was presented to the conference audience, followed by a press conference to allow the panel to respond to questions from the media. After its release at the conference, the draft statement was made available on the Internet. The panel's final statement is available at http://consensus.nih.gov. CONCLUSIONS: The panel concluded that the available evidence supports a variety of interventions for treating cancer patients' pain, depression, and fatigue. Clinicians should routinely use brief assessment tools to ask patients about pain, depression, and fatigue and to initiate evidence-based treatments. Assessment should include discussion about common symptoms experienced by cancer patients, and these discussions should continue over the duration of the illness. Impediments to effective symptom management in cancer patients can arise from different sources and interactions among providers, patients and their families, and the health care system. Numerous factors could interfere with adequate symptom management. Among these factors are incomplete effectiveness of some treatments, a lack of sufficient knowledge regarding effective treatment strategies, patient reluctance to report symptoms to caregivers, a belief that such symptoms are simply a part of the cancer experience that must be tolerated, and inadequate coverage and reimbursement for some treatments. Additional research is needed on the definition, occurrence, the treatment of pain, depression, and fatigue, alone and in combination, in adequately funded prospective studies. The panel also concluded that the state of the science in cancer symptom management should be reassessed periodically.

PURPOSE: To prospectively evaluate the feasibility of delivering 70 Gy once-daily thoracic radiotherapy (TRT), concurrent with chemotherapy, in the treatment of limited-stage small-cell lung cancer (L-SCLC). MATERIALS AND METHODS: Eligible patients received two cycles of induction paclitaxel (175 mg/m(2) on Day 1) and topotecan (1 mg/m(2) on Days 1-5) with granulocyte colony stimulating factor support, followed by three cycles of carboplatin (area under the curve = 5 on Day 1) and etoposide (100 mg/m(2) on Days 1-3). TRT (70 Gy, 2 Gy/fx/7 weeks) was initiated with the first cycle of carboplatin and etoposide. Prophylactic cranial irradiation was offered to patients achieving a complete response or good partial response. RESULTS: Ninety percent of patients (57 of 63) proceeded to protocol TRT. There was one treatment-related fatality. Nonhematologic Grade 3/4 toxicities affecting more than 10% of patients, during or after TRT, were dysphagia (16%/5%) and febrile neutropenia (12%/4%). The response rate to all therapy was 92% and the median overall survival is 22.4 months (95% confidence interval 16.1, infinity ). Twenty-eight patients remain alive with a median follow-up of 24.7 months. CONCLUSION: 70 Gy once-daily TRT can be delivered safely in the cooperative group setting for patients with L-SCLC. Initial efficacy data are encouraging. The hypothesis that high-dose once-daily TRT results in comparable or improved survival compared with twice-daily accelerated TRT warrants testing in a Phase III trial.

The clinical management of non-small cell lung cancer (NSCLC) would benefit greatly by a test that was able to detect small amounts of NSCLC in the peripheral blood. In this report, we used a novel strategy to enrich tumor cells from the peripheral blood of 24 stage I to IV NSCLC patients and determined expression levels for six cancer-associated genes (lunx, muc1, KS1/4, CEA, CK19, and PSE). Using thresholds established at three standard deviations above the mean observed in 15 normal controls, we observed that lunx (10 of 24, 42%), muc1 (5 of 24, 21%), and CK19 (5 of 24, 21%) were overexpressed in 14 of 24 (58%) peripheral blood samples obtained from NSCLC patients. Patients who overexpressed either KS1/4 (n = 2) or PSE (n = 1) also overexpressed either lunx or muc1. Of patients with presumed curable and resectable stage I to II disease (n = 7), at least one marker was overexpressed in three (43%) patients. In advanced stage III to IV patients (n = 17), at least one marker was overexpressed in 11 patients (65%). These results provide evidence that circulating tumor cells can be detected in NSCLC patients by a high throughput molecular technique. Further studies are needed to determine the clinical relevance of gene overexpression.

PURPOSE: To determine acute and late complications for bladder and rectum and to determine dose-volume correlations. METHODS AND MATERIALS: Sixty-four patients received definitive treatment for prostate cancer between January 1995 and December 1998 using conformal three-dimensional radiotherapy. Doses ranged from 72 to 80Gy. The acute and late side effects were gathered retrospectively, and graded according to Radiotherapy and Oncology Group criteria (RTOG). The patients were divided into two groups: or=76Gy (Group B) and had a mean follow-up of 32 and 22 months, respectively. RESULTS: No grades 3-4 acute, urinary or rectal toxicity was reported. Acute grade 2 rectal complications were seen in 10 and 18% of the patients in Groups A and B, respectively. They were observed at a mean dose of 38Gy. Acute grade 2 urinary symptoms were 33 and 47% for Groups A and B, respectively. They were seen at a mean dose of 43Gy. Acute rectal symptoms were dose-volume related. Patients without diarrhea had a mean rectal volume receiving a dose of 70Gy or more of 8.5 cm(3). However, patients with RTOG 2 diarrhea had a volume of 16.5 cm(3) (P=0.042). No dose-volume relationship for acute bladder symptoms or late complications were seen. Grades 1-2 late rectal and bladder complications were seen in 11 and 8% of the patients, respectively. None required hospital admission or transfusion. CONCLUSION: Radiotherapy to the prostate can be given at 80Gy. No grades 3-4 acute, urinary or rectal toxicity was reported. Acute rectal symptoms are dose-volume related.

Small cell lung cancer accounts for less than 20% of all lung cancer. The management of this distinct tumor entity differs from the more common non-small cell lung cancer. Primary prevention of smoking exposure remains the most important public health measure. Although small cell lung is an exquisitely chemosensitive disease it remains ultimately fatal for the great majority of patients. Combination chemotherapy regimens have improved response rate and survival of the last three decades. The combination of cisplatin and etoposide has been considered the standard therapy for over a decade. More intensive triplet combination chemotherapy and high-dose chemotherapy have shown improved response rates and survival. Early concomitant and accelerated radiotherapy improves survival in limited stage disease. This review summarizes the current state of the art and future perspectives in detection, staging and standard therapy of small cell lung cancer. Particular emphasis is given to the importance of concomitant and accelerated radiotherapy and consideration of dose-intensive combination chemotherapy regimens.

Chemotherapy for extensive-stage small-cell lung cancer (E-SCLC) produces high response rates and improved survival but few cures. We tested three new regimens for E-SCLC that might merit further investigation in a subsequent phase III trial. Cancer and Leukemia Group B 9430 was a randomized phase II study evaluating 4 treatment arms in 57 evaluable, previously untreated E-SCLC patients. Each arm consisted of the following: Arm 1: cisplatin plus topotecan; Arm 2: cisplatin plus paclitaxel; Arm 3: paclitaxel 230 mg/m2 plus topotecan; and Arm 4: paclitaxel 175 mg/m2 plus topotecan. Because of an accrual time difference, Arm 2 will not be discussed in this manuscript. Arm 1 (12 patients) produced 1 complete response (CR, 8%) and an overall response rate (ORR) of 42%. Toxicity was excessive, with 3 deaths (25%). Arm 3 (13 patients) produced no CRs, 7 partial responses (PRs, 54%), median survival of 13.8 months, and failure-free survival (FFS) of 7.41 months, with 3 toxic deaths (25%). Among 32 evaluable patients on Arm 4, there were 2 CRs (6%) and 20 PRs (63%) for an ORR of 69%, median survival of 9.9 months, FFS of 5.21 months, and 1-year survival of 40%. There was 1 possible treatment-related death (3%). Topotecan plus cisplatin, in the doses and schedule employed, produced excessive toxicity and modest efficacy in E-SCLC patients. Paclitaxel (230 mg/m2 on day 1) plus topotecan (1 mg/m2 on days 1-5) produced excessive toxicity that was ameliorated with an attenuated paclitaxel dose (175 mg/m2). With the latter regimen (Arm 4) in patients with a performance status of 0/1, CR rates, FFS, overall survival, and 1-year survival were similar to standard etoposide plus cisplatin chemotherapy. Further exploration of topoisomerase inhibitors and taxanes in SCLC patients is warranted.

Radiotherapy has an expanding role in all phases of treatment of nonsmall cell lung cancer. Evolutions in technique, such as three-dimensional conformal radiotherapy, hold the promise for more effective treatment of patients with early stage disease who are not candidates for surgical intervention. Multimodality therapy for patients with locally advanced disease is evolving rapidly, with evidence accruing as to the optimal schedules and doses of radiotherapy and combination chemotherapy. Palliative dose schedules are being refined that maximize patient comfort while providing substantial symptom relief.

PURPOSE: In lung cancer, randomized trials assessing hyperfractionated or accelerated radiotherapy seem to yield conflicting results regarding the effects on overall (OS) or progression-free survival (PFS). The Meta-Analysis of Radiotherapy in Lung Cancer Collaborative Group decided to address the role of modified radiotherapy fractionation. MATERIAL AND METHODS: We performed an individual patient data meta-analysis in patients with nonmetastatic lung cancer, which included trials comparing modified radiotherapy with conventional radiotherapy. RESULTS: In non-small-cell lung cancer (NSCLC; 10 trials, 2,000 patients), modified fractionation improved OS as compared with conventional schedules (hazard ratio [HR] = 0.88, 95% CI, 0.80 to 0.97; P = .009), resulting in an absolute benefit of 2.5% (8.3% to 10.8%) at 5 years. No evidence of heterogeneity between trials was found. There was no evidence of a benefit on PFS (HR = 0.94; 95% CI, 0.86 to 1.03; P = .19). Modified radiotherapy reduced deaths resulting from lung cancer (HR = 0.89; 95% CI, 0.81 to 0.98; P = .02), and there was a nonsignificant reduction of non-lung cancer deaths (HR = 0.87; 95% CI, 0.66 to 1.15; P = .33). In small-cell lung cancer (SCLC; two trials, 685 patients), similar results were found: OS, HR = 0.87, 95% CI, 0.74 to 1.02, P = .08; PFS, HR = 0.88, 95% CI, 0.75 to 1.03, P = .11. In both NSCLC and SCLC, the use of modified radiotherapy increased the risk of acute esophageal toxicity (odds ratio [OR] = 2.44 in NSCLC and OR = 2.41 in SCLC; P < .001) but did not have an impact on the risk of other acute toxicities. CONCLUSION: Patients with nonmetastatic NSCLC derived a significant OS benefit from accelerated or hyperfractionated radiotherapy; a similar but nonsignificant trend was observed for SCLC. As expected, there was increased acute esophageal toxicity.

PURPOSE: The aim of this study was to compare toxicities, disease control, survival outcomes, and patterns of failure between groups of limited-stage small-cell lung cancer patients treated with once-daily versus twice-daily radiotherapy and concurrent chemotherapy. MATERIALS AND METHODS: This single-institution retrospective analysis included a comparison of two of radiotherapy regimens to planned doses of (1) > or =59.4 Gy at 1.8-2.0 Gy per once-daily fraction or (2) > or =45 Gy at 1.5 Gy per twice-daily fractions with concurrent platinum-based chemotherapy. Comparative analyses of toxicities and disease control were performed. RESULTS: A total of 71 patients were included in the present study (17 once-daily, 54 twice-daily). Patient, tumor, staging, and treatment factors were similar between the two treatment groups. Median planned radiotherapy doses were 60 Gy (range 59.4-70.0 Gy) and 45 Gy (range 45-51 Gy) for the once-daily and twice-daily groups, respectively. Acute toxicities were similar between the groups ( approximately 20% grade 3 esophagitis). At a median survival follow-up of 26.2 months (range 3.4-85.5 months), 42 patients had died. The 2-year overall survival estimates were similar at 43% and 49% for the once-daily versus twice-daily groups, respectively. Isolated in-field failures were similar between the two groups ( approximately 17%). CONCLUSION: The present analysis did not detect a statistically significant difference in acute toxicities, disease control, or survival outcomes in limited-stage small-cell lung cancer patients treated with concurrent chemotherapy and once-daily versus twice-daily radiotherapy.
